The best way to start, from my experience, is to just start writing. The two most popular blogging platforms on the internet are: http://www.blogger.com/ and http://wordpress.com/
I started on blogger and still have my old blogs there. I am a hoarder at heart and just can’t bear to let them go. I use them only to make money now though. They have gone commercialized. I like the two sites I mentioned (Blogger and WordPress) because their platforms are pretty intuitive. Just follow the instructions and you will be blogging in no time.
Once you’ve have your blog set up, just start writing away! You’re worried no one will read you? The best way to get others to read your stuff is to start reading their stuff and commenting on them. That’s how blogging works. It’s about people putting their ideas out there and sharing them with the world. No matter what topic you’re writing about, you’ll find other like minded people out there who will want to hear what you’ve got to say.
But…. “Can I make money?” you ask. The short answer is YES. Yes, you can make money blogging but don’t quit your day job yet. Once you have your blog going, you can start investigating ways to make money. The easiest way is to add Google Adsense to your blog. The money you make will depend on how many people read your blog. The more people read your blog, the more money you can make.
While you’re starting your blog, start reading up on how to make money. Just google “make money from blogging” and you will find various sites that will give you tips and tutorials. You may want to check out http://problogger.com/. You will find a lot of information there. I suggest starting with his Blogging 101 series.
Don’t expect to start making money right away. The older your blog, the more readers you have and the relevance of your content will all affect how much money you can make. Some people who really work at it have been known to start making money right away, but most take longer. Depends on how much time you want to put into it.

BEST ADVICE: As you read more about blogging, you will find this advice given over and over again. “CONTENT IS KING”. What it means is that if you have good content and learn how to utilize all the tools available to promote your content, your readers will find you. They will come and they will stay if you engage them.
